ZOSOs extended for another 180 days

The House of Representatives on Tuesday afternoon approved an extension of the Zones of Special Operations (ZOSO) in several communities across the island.
 
National Security Minister Dr. Horace Chang piloted a motion for the extensions in Denham Town, Mount Salem, August Town, Greenwich Town, Parade Gardens, Norwood and Savannah-la-mar.
 
The 180-day extension will expire in June 2025.
 
In reacting to a question from Opposition Leader Mark Golding as to when the government will establish ZOSOs in other troubled communities, Dr. Chang said the government is considering ending the Zone of Special Operations in the Mount Salem community and to "pivot into another area". 
 
Where Denham Town is concerned, Dr. Chang said the programme's "clear, hold and build" strategy has not worked as well as expected. 
 
While the community has been cleared "to some extent" resulting in a significant decline in the level violence, and 'holding' has been working despite some challenges, the minister said the build phase has not been going smoothly. 
 
He said the government will be reviewing how to proceed with these activities as they seek to close out in that community and extend to other areas.
